主要内容

使用App Designer创建和运行简单的应用程序

App Designer提供了一个教程,指导您通过创建包含包含绘图和滑块的简单应用程序的过程。滑块控制绘图功能的幅度。您可以通过运行教程来创建此应用程序,或者您可以遵循此处列出的教程步骤。

经营教程

要在App Designer中运行教程,请打开App Designer Start Page并展开例子:一般部分。然后,选择互动教程

创建应用程序的教程步骤

在App Designer中执行以下步骤。

  1. 组件来自组件库到画布上。

  2. 滑块组件来自组件库到画布上。将其放在轴下,如在前面的图像中。

  3. 替换滑块标签文本。双击标签并替换单词滑块振幅

  4. 在画布上方,点击代码视图编辑代码。(请注意,通过单击,您可以切换回编辑您的布局设计视图。)

  5. 在代码视图中,添加执行MATLAB的回调函数®每当用户移动滑块时都会命令。右键点击app.amplitudeslider.在里面组件浏览器。然后选择回调>添加ValueChangedFCN回调在上下文菜单中。App Designer创建回调函数并将光标放在该函数的正文中。

  6. 绘图在轴上的功能。将此命令添加到第二行Amplitudeslidervaluechanged打回来:

    情节(app.uiadxes,值*峰值)
    请注意阴谋命令指定目标轴(app.uiadxes.)作为第一个论点。当您称之为时,始终需要目标轴阴谋App Designer中的命令。

  7. 改变的限制y-axis通过设置ylim.财产的财产Uiacxes.目的。将此命令添加到第三行Amplitudeslidervaluechanged打回来:

    app.uiaxes.ylim = [-1000 1000];
    请注意,该命令使用点表示法来访问ylim.财产。始终使用模式应用程序成分财产访问属性值。

  8. 点击保存并运行应用程序。保存更改后,您的应用程序可用于在App Designer中再次运行,或通过键入其名称(没有.mlapp.扩展名)在MATLAB命令提示符下。从命令提示符运行应用程序时,文件必须在当前文件夹或MATLAB路径上。

相关话题